Jazz was always a crowd's type of music. You look at New Orleans, or even go back to the slave traditions, and it wasn't 5 professionals on a heightened stage, and everybody else sat in comfortable chairs, stroking their chin watching.

I was at a concert the other night, and the sax player on stage saw one of his buddies come through the door. This was all during an very good vibes solo, so I was a bit angered when the sax player starts to wave his buddy into a seat right next to the stage. The sax player then started to take pictures of this guy and his girlfriend. But then I realized, jazz has turned into listening to the vibes player solo, and has turned away from having fun with music.

This is in part due to recording. With a recording you can very easily sit in your room and study exactly what the drummer is doing, or what the piano player is doing, and the CD becomes an educational tool for understanding jazz. That is a very necessary part of learning to play jazz, but people have began to take that educational look on all of jazz. It would be very hard to have a party in the middle of the Half Note while Coltrane is playing away, or to not want to study Bird's playing at Minton's playhouse. I respect those venues greatly. But I think jazz also should encourage a revival of the older traditions where everybody (musicians included) can dance and shout and have fun. You don't see that much anymore, at least in the commercial jazz scenes.

I was fortunate to talk with Eric Gravat today. He really is an intriguingly man. He worked with McCoy Tyner and Weather Report back in the day, and became a prison guard after his wife died, so he could support his children. I guess he stopped playing with McCoy after there was no ticket for him at the airport. Eric later found out that the ticket was under the name Grazat. He has reentered the jazz scene at 60 some years old and is playing with McCoy again along with his own group, Source Code.

The man is a wealth of jazz information. He talked about standing outside a club listening to the Coltrane quartet live. He also said that someone recommended him to Miles Davis, but that he never got to play with Miles. And apparently after a Weather Report gig Miles was standing by the soda machines Eric was visiting and Miles said (Eric can do Miles' voice perfectly) "you sounded great Eric. The rest of the band was shit". I was shaking hearing him talk about Miles Davis and McCoy Tyner so casually, as if they were his buds, which they are.

What I liked best was a little twist on a popular story in jazz. Miles says to Coltrane "why do you play so long" and Coltrane responds "once I get going I just don't know how to stop" and (the new twist) Miles retorts "pull the fucking horn out of your mouth".

Fibonacci sequence and music

May 05, 2008 | |

An interesting video can be found here about the Fibonacci sequence and music. The video shows that if you assign each musical note a number and then apply those numbers to the numbers in the Fibonacci sequence you will get a repeating musical pattern. I will first explain his idea in my own way, and then add another dimension using the terminology I set forth.

In the video he says C=1, C#=2, D=3 ... A=10, A#=11, B=12, C=13. I don't like this. Instead I will use base 12 instead of base 10. So then C = 1, C#=2... A=A, A#=B, B=10, C=11.

The Fibonacci sequence (for those who don't want to read the rather lengthy and intense wikipedia article) was found by Fibonacci, an Italian mathematician. It was used to explain a problem about rabbit reproduction, but is much more important than that. The sequence goes 0,1,1,2,3,5,8,13... Each number is created by adding the two before it. So the next number in the sequence is 21. The sequence is hugely related with the golden proportion.

But as I stated, we are using base 12, not base 10, so we need to convert the Fibonacci sequence.
